Ticket: TimeWeave solver produces overlapping assignments for split-shift teachers when a room is marked unavailable mid-week. Reproduced on the Larkfield demo dataset: two classes land in the same slot despite the hard constraint. The regression appeared after the constraint-pruning change in the optimizer module. On-call: please do not restart the solver pool, as that clears the diagnostic buffer. The failing run emitted the trace token shown below.

pipeline stamp: htk9_ce63042d9

Handover notes for the Drossel tile-rendering cache. Short version: it's solid, just moody. The cache layer sits between the Vanterre renderer and object storage; evictions run hourly. If tiles come back stale, flush the warm tier only — a full flush hammers the renderer for a day. Full rebuilds need the cache admin store unlocked, and the passphrase for that sits right below this paragraph.

strongbox words: fraath-isteth

Ticket: StormRelay fan-out — signature verification failing

Weather-alert fan-out workers reject the new dispatch config. Verifier error: digest mismatch on every node in the Hollis region. Timeline: config built Tuesday, key rotated Wednesday, deploy Thursday. Old key was revoked before the re-sign job ran, so the artifact carries a dead signature. Fix in review: rebuild, re-sign, redeploy in one pipeline stage instead of three. Reviewer: confirm the re-sign stage pins the correct fingerprint. The expected signing key is below.

signing key of fajop-tahop = bky9_qdL6xeDv7